CM Unveils 25 Development Projects Worth ₹410 Crore in Navi Mumbai.

In a significant boost to infrastructure ahead of the assembly elections, Chief Minister Eknath Shinde inaugurated 25 projects totaling ₹410 crore in Navi Mumbai on Friday. The event included the groundbreaking for several new initiatives aimed at enhancing public services in the region.

Among the notable projects inaugurated was an Olympic-size public swimming pool in Vashi, marking a first for the city, along with the establishment of an indoor vehicle parking facility at CBD Belapur, which will accommodate over 400 cars. Additionally, a bhoomipujan ceremony was held for a Maharashtra Bhavan to be constructed on Cidco land at Vashi station, with a budget of ₹121 crore.

The range of projects inaugurated includes a cancer screening facility at 13 primary civil health centers, a 10-bed chemotherapy unit at Nerul Hospital, educational institutions, markets, health centers, water bodies, e-buses, and e-charging stations. CM Shinde also initiated the concreting of Ghansoli Palm Beach Road and the construction of stormwater drainage and footpaths, amounting to ₹52.5 crore.

Accompanied by Deputy Chief Minister Devendra Fadnavis and other ministers, Shinde highlighted the impact of the Ladki Bahin scheme, stating that over 1.45 lakh women in Navi Mumbai have directly benefited from it. In a move to further support women commuters, he announced a 50% discount on fares for women traveling on Navi Mumbai Municipal Transport buses.

Fadnavis, during the event, inaugurated the centralized building for Maharashtra Cyber Security in Mahape, emphasizing that the new cyber security center is equipped with advanced technology to combat cybercrime targeting vulnerable citizens.
